IPOF.WS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2022 in Review
38 of the 5,959 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Social Capital Hedosophia Holdings Corp. VI Redeemable warrants, each whole warrant exercisable for one Class A ordinary share at an exercise price of $11.50 (IPOF.WS) for Q2 2022, worth a combined $4.45M — down 65% from $12.6M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 6 funds opened new IPOF.WS positions and 5 closed out — a net gain of 1 holder — while 7 added to existing stakes and 6 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Cambridge Investment Research Advisors, adding an estimated $771K. The largest seller was LH Capital Markets, exiting entirely with an estimated $1.84M sold.
